Researchers discover two Bluetooth security flaws that can affect any device from 2014 on

This is one of those things that make you cringe and hope there’s a firmware update to resolve it in the works. Two recently-discovered Bluetooth security flaws allow attackers to hijack the connections of all devices using Bluetooth 4.2 to 5.4, a range that encompasses all devices between late 2014 and now. Windows App update will allow for Windows apps to be run remotely through Macs, iPhones, and iPads

Microsoft’s updated Windows App will soon allow Windows apps to run on Apple devices such as Macs, iPhones, and iPads without requiring a local PC to act as a host.
